Stop Carbon Monoxide Poisoning

Carbon monoxide is a invisible and unscented gas formed when propellants is partially burned. A clogged or unclean chimney might hinder proper CO discharge, permitting it to gather inside of the residence. Increased amounts of CO in the atmosphere can be extremely unsafe, even lethal. Periodic flue cleanings can aid make sure no zero impediments or stoppages which could cause CO buildup, consequently ensuring you safe.

Avoiding Chimney Fires

A major most compelling reasons to prioritize routine chimney sweeping is the prevention of blazes in the flue. Residues can accumulate over time within the chimney, generating an ignitable atmosphere. If not addressed, these can ignite, resulting in an lethal blaze that rapidly extends through the home. You can dramatically lower the risk of fires in the chimney and protect the well-being of your and your via scheduling regular fireplace cleanings.

Chimney Safety Tips

A fireplace is a truly gorgeous enhancement to your appearance of the residence, however it might additionally pose risks if you haven't dedicated the effort to ensure that the chimney is in good condition. Observe the procedures below to assure the safety of your household's chimney:

Schedule a Chimney Inspection

The primary actions in assuring the chimney is secure is is to arrange for it checked and cleared in case needed. Since the inspecting professional is able to advise you about the state of the chimney, you can avoid potential blazes or CO poisoning.

Cover Your Chimney

Secure your chimney whenever it's not in use. A high-quality cap is normally composed of stainless steel, preventing oxidation. Such a cap serves with the goal of block animals, dust, and leaves from clogging the gas.

Keep It Simple

Be sure to maintain a a safe distance away from your furniture and any fireplace. Being exposed to high temperatures holds the potential to ignite with time.

Install a Screen or a Door

Adding safety screens or glass panel doors covering your fireplace can aid manage embers and keep them clear of any rug or furniture. When you have little ones, this will add a further layer of security. In the case of glass panel doors, never shut them closed during an active fire.

Detectors That Work

Double-check that your fire and CO alarms are up-to-date and functional. Position these devices on your ceiling, as this is the most probable spot for the ascent of smoke or CO.

Fire Starter

Utilize a fire starter specifically designed for use inside a fireplace. It's not allowed to use utilize fuel, lighter fluid, or a charcoal grill lighter. These lighting methods can cause flames to get excessively large, increasing the chances of a. Furthermore, a few of these are regarded as to be an accelerant, which can may leave residues within the flue, perhaps causing an inside of your chimney.

Clean Outside the Chimney

While the inside part of the chimney is commonly discussed since it is the most prominent part, the area surrounding your home's chimney also equally vital. Ensure that the surroundings around your chimney is tidy and that there are tree branches obstructing the upper section.

Maintain a Small Flame

Refrain from burning an overly large load of firewood simultaneously. The location for combusting wood is at a grate close to the rear section of the fireplace. Burning firewood at one time can result in accumulated creosote with time, which might lead to chimney stack cracking.

Keep an eye on the Fire

Do not ever walk away from an unattended fire. Sparks and logs can fall from the grate as it is burning, and these could fly. These flying embers holds the chance to initiate a fire.

Bear Creek is a census-designated place (CDP) in Kenai Peninsula Borough, Alaska, United States. At the 2020 census the population was 2,129 up from 1,956 in 2010. Bear Creek is a few miles north of Seward near the stream of the same name and its source, Bear Lake.
